Mumbai's development rules got the headlines, but the bigger regulatory event for most Maharashtra developers happened quieter: UDCPR 2020 replaced dozens of city-specific DC rulebooks with one code for practically everything outside Greater Mumbai. A Deshmukh family parcel in Nashik, a PCMC society plot and a Nagpur commercial corner now speak the same FSI language. Here is that language, and the arithmetic it enables.

One code, two Maharashtras
UDCPR's structure rests on a distinction older city rules also drew but applied chaotically: congested areas (the historic gaothans and city cores) versus non-congested areas (everything newer). The congested core gets conservative entitlements driven by narrow road widths; non-congested land gets the full modern stack. Every entitlement then keys off the same variables: road width, plot size, zone and jurisdiction class, which is what makes feasibility portable. Learn the framework once and it prices parcels from Kolhapur to Amravati.
The assembly logic mirrors Mumbai's DCPR 2034 stack: a basic FSI that comes free, premium FSI purchased from the planning authority at ready-reckoner-linked rates, TDR bought in the market and loaded within road-width caps, and on top of the assembled figure, UDCPR's distinctive layer, ancillary FSI. As one reported example of the stack's shape: on 9 to 18 metre roads in non-congested residential areas, a base entitlement around 2.0 could take roughly 0.3 more on premium payment and roughly 0.3 by TDR loading, reaching about 2.6 (The Hitavada's analysis at UDCPR's notification, December 2020); the precise slab for any parcel comes from the current regulations and the local authority's implementation.
Ancillary FSI: the layer that changes the spreadsheet
UDCPR's most consequential invention is ancillary FSI: up to 60 percent additional FSI for residential use, and up to 80 percent for non-residential, granted against a premium linked to the ready reckoner rate, with the percentage charged varying by city class. It regularised the staircases, lifts, lobbies and service areas that older codes half-counted, and converted them into a purchasable, sellable entitlement.
The math consequence is blunt: a non-congested residential parcel assembling 2.0 of conventional FSI can, with full ancillary uptake, plan structures around 3.2, with the increment priced not by negotiation but by the reckoner. That single layer is why post-2020 launches in Pune's suburbs carry visibly more built-up per plot than their 2018 neighbours, and why ready reckoner revisions now move developer costs across the whole state, not just Mumbai.
Source: UDCPR 2020 structure; slab example as reported by The Hitavada, December 2020; ancillary percentages per UDCPR provisions
An analogy: the state standardised the exam
Before UDCPR, every city set its own exam: same subject, different syllabus, different marking. A developer crossing from PCMC to Nashik relearned the rules from scratch, and the relearning cost was a moat protecting local incumbents. UDCPR standardised the exam statewide. The syllabus is now public and portable, which shrinks the incumbents' moat and widens the opportunity for any developer, or land owner, willing to actually read it. Deshmukh (our illustrative Nashik land owner) discovered this from the selling side: two developers bid on his parcel quoting "what the plot can take". One quoted the pre-2020 instinct; one quoted the UDCPR stack with ancillary priced in. The bids differed by a third, and the difference was not generosity. It was arithmetic the first bidder hoped he would not do.
The two facts that swing UDCPR feasibility hardest are also the two most often assumed instead of verified: whether the parcel sits in a congested area (check the development plan, not the neighbourhood's vibe) and the recorded width of the abutting road (check the DP road, not the tar). Every layer of the stack keys off these; get them wrong and the whole pro forma is fiction.
Where the register meets the rulebook
UDCPR tells you what a parcel may build; the MahaRERA register tells you what nearby parcels actually built and how fast it sold, which is the demand half of the same feasibility, the method from the series opener. A registration's unit table against its plot area implies the FSI stack local developers achieved, and their quarterly bookings tell you whether the market absorbed it, discipline no FSI spreadsheet supplies on its own. The one-line summary
One code now governs Maharashtra outside Mumbai: basic plus premium plus TDR, gated by road width and congestion status, with up to 60 percent ancillary FSI purchasable at reckoner-linked rates on top. Verify the congested classification and the DP road width first, price the stack all-in per sellable metre, and read the neighbours' filings before trusting any parcel's paper potential.
